About this Episode

Responsive Web Design: How has responsive web design changed things for web design shops?

About the Show

This is Draft, a show about the craft of designing for the web. Your hosts are Giovanni DiFeterici (@giodif ) and Gene Crawford (@genecrawford) both from this little old website right here: UnmatchedStyle.
